Frequently asked questions

What is the name of Sarraguzan's airport?
Tarbes - Lourdes - Pyrenees Intl. Airport (LDE) is the sole airport in Sarraguzan.
How far is Tarbes - Lourdes - Pyrenees Intl. Airport (LDE) from central Sarraguzan?
Tarbes - Lourdes - Pyrenees Intl. Airport (LDE) is 32 kilometres from downtown Sarraguzan, so expect a reasonable commute into the city.
What airport is best to fly into Sarraguzan?
Tarbes - Lourdes - Pyrenees Intl. Airport is the only major airport in Sarraguzan. Before you take off, it’s a smart idea to research a little about it. The terminal sits 32 kilometres from the downtown area.
How many airlines fly to Sarraguzan?
With 3 airlines flying into Sarraguzan from 9 airports across the globe, your ideal flight is only a few clicks away.
Which airlines fly to Sarraguzan?
Flights into Sarraguzan are typically operated by Volotea. The majority of these flights take off from Orly, with Volotea servicing this route the most.
How many nonstop flights are there to Sarraguzan?
Arranging an awesome Sarraguzan escape is a walk in the park when there are 32 direct flights each week to pick from.
Where are the most popular flights to Sarraguzan departing from?
Flights to Sarraguzan departing from London, Rome and Dublin airports are highly sought after.
How long is the flight to Sarraguzan Airport?
If it’s Orly you’re departing, you’ll be in the air for around 1 hour and 25 minutes before you touchdown in Sarraguzan. Tarmac to tarmac from London takes approximately 1 hour and 50 minutes and from Strasbourg, 1 hour and 40 minutes.

How to survive the flight to Sarraguzan?
We’ve got the lowdown on how to make your flight as stress-free as possible. Follow our insider tips and you’ll be speeding through the airport and having a ball in Sarraguzan in no time at all.What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• Firstly, and most importantly, pack in your passport, travel docs, cash and medications. Next, you’ll want some in-flight entertainment to help pass the time. A thrilling novel and a tablet crammed with your favourite movies are good options. If you intend to take a quick nap, a quality neck pillow and a pair of earplugs will also be useful. Finally, squeeze in a toothbrush and some facial wipes to ensure you arrive looking fresh and raring to go.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Pack all your full-sized bottles of shampoo and hair gel in your checked luggage. Any liquids in your carry-on bag lar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) will be confiscated by authorities. Pointed or sharp objects, like your precious Swiss Army knife, and dangerous goods which are explosive or flammable, such as aerosol cans, flares and fuels, are also restricted.

What to wear on a flight:

  • Comfort should always be your highest priority when deciding what to wear on your flight. Consider your choice of footwear carefully too, as swollen feet and ankles can be a side effect of flying. Flat shoes which are slightly roomy are your best bet.
  • The condition called de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a potential risk on long-haul flights. It’s the result of blood clots forming due to poor circulation and inactivity. Walking up and down the aisle and doing leg and foot exercises while seated helps to prevent this occurring. Wearing a good-quality pair of compression socks may also help.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Sarraguzan?
Being organised before you arrive at the airport can make your getaway to Sarraguzan a breeze. Here are some handy tips and tricks for a stress-free journey past security:

  • Airport security personnel first need to verify that you have a valid passport and boarding pass before you’re allowed to proceed any further. Have them ready to show.
  • The X-ray machine comes next. Empty your pockets and remove anything that is likely to set off the alarm. This includes things like headphones or earphones, as well as heavy jackets or coats. They’ll all need to go on the X-ray conveyor belt.
  • For just a few minutes, you’ll have to unplug from technology. Your phone, tablet and any other electronics also need to be sent through the scanner.
  • Any gels or liquids, such as shampoo or hand cream, that you want to bring on board need to be in containers no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ters). Also, everything must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-close bag.
  • Choosing your footwear wisely can save you several valuable minutes. Boots are often required to be removed and separately scanned. Slip-on sneakers are usually not.
  • Airlines won’t allow any pocket knives or other sharp items in the cabin. If you need to bring these kinds of items, pack them safely in your checked luggage.
